Abstract

Traditionally, the water quality detection especially for aquaculture industries like shrimp aquaculture has been carried out manually wherein the water samples are collected and taken to the laboratories for analysis. Since these methods fail to deliver real time data, we propose a real time water quality monitoring system based on wireless sensor network which helps in continuous and remote monitoring of the water quality data. The application of wireless sensor network (WSN) for a water quality monitoring is composed of a number of sensor nodes with a networking capability that can be deployed for an ad hoc or continuous monitoring purpose. The parameters involved in the water quality determination such as the pH level, conductivity, dissolve oxygen and temperature is measured in the real time by the sensors that send the data to the base station or control/monitoring room. The use of wireless system for monitoring purpose will not only reduce the overall monitoring system cost in term of facilities setup and labour cost, but will also provide flexibility in term of distance or location. In this project, the fundamental design and implementation of WSN featuring a high power transmission Zigbee based technology together with the IEEE 802.15.4 compatible transceiver is proposed. The water quality data will be display using visual studio platform as graphical user interface (GUI).
